Big corporations tend to prepare the multi-step income statement due to the size and complexity of their businesses. These businesses, such as large manufacturing companies and giant retailers, usually have various revenue streams, and they will need to record down the income in different accounts....

Essentially, accounts expenses represent the cost of doing business; they are the sum of all the activities that hopefully generate a profit.
